Jill Monaco Ministries Launches Single Matters Online Magazine

The online magazine provides support and advice for single Christian men and women in the areas of relationships, career, faith and family.

SOUTHLAKE, TX, June 12, 2013

Jill Monaco Ministries announced the launch of its newest outreach to Christian singles, Single Matters (www.singlematters.com), a "webzine" that equips, informs and connects singles over 30. The website addresses the needs of the single man and woman by bringing them a message of hope within four categories: Faith, Life, Relationships and Singleness. Topics include dating, being single again (divorced or widowed), single parenting, preparing for marriage, community, sex, purity, health, career, money, prayer and spiritual development.

According to Editor-in-Chief Jill Monaco, "Our ministry team created Single Matters to reach out to the large and growing population of unmarried Christians. Research has shown that with changing societal values, delay of marriage, divorce and other factors, more than 50 percent of Americans are still unmarried. The purpose of the online magazine is to reach out to men and women wherever they are on their singleness journey - whether they desire to remain single or want to prepare for a marriage that lasts. We hope the reach of the webzine extends to help singles worldwide."

Most articles on Single Matters are free to all users, though membership is encouraged. Membership offers the ability to comment on articles, engage in community, access member-only content and receive ministry partner discounts, among other perks. See the website for membership details.

Single Matters is a program of Jill Monaco Ministries, a 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ization.
